Second form English language words

Cards (50)

  • What does "adamant" mean?

    Firm and unyielding in opinion
  • What is the definition of "affluent"?

    Wealthy; having an abundance of money
  • What does "aesthetic" refer to?

    Concerned with beauty or appreciation of beauty
  • What does "alight" mean?

    To descend and settle after flying
  • What does "bilingual" mean?

    Able to speak two languages fluently
  • What does "bulbous" describe?

    Fat, round, or bulging
  • What does "berate" mean?

    To scold or criticize angrily
  • What does "catatonic" refer to?

    Unresponsive or in a daze
  • What does "chivalrous" mean?

    Courteous and gallant, especially toward women
  • What does "clandestine" mean?

    Kept secret or done secretly
  • What is "cohesion"?

    The action of forming a united whole
  • What does "convalesce" mean?

    To recover health after illness
  • What does "conscious" mean?

    Aware of and responding to surroundings
  • What is "debt"?

    Something owed, usually money
  • What does "derelict" mean?

    In poor condition due to neglect
  • What is a "despot"?

    A ruler with absolute power
  • What does "dubious" mean?

    Doubtful or suspicious
  • What does "eccentric" describe?

    Unconventional and slightly strange
  • What does "effervescent" mean?

    Bubbly, lively, and enthusiastic
  • What does "emaciate" mean?

    To become abnormally thin or weak
  • What does "extravagant" mean?

    Lacking restraint in spending money
  • What does "furtive" mean?

    Secretive or attempting to avoid notice
  • What does "frugal" mean?

    Sparing or economical with resources
  • What does "gallant" mean?

    Brave, heroic, or chivalrous
  • What does "hazy" mean?

    Unclear, vague, or misty
  • What does "hyperbolic" mean?

    Exaggerated or overstated
  • What does "ignoble" mean?

    Dishonorable or shameful
  • What does "imperious" mean?

    Arrogant and domineering
  • What does "infantile" mean?

    Childish or immature
  • What does "lackadaisical" mean?

    Lacking enthusiasm or determination
  • What does "lithe" mean?

    Flexible and graceful
  • What is a "mortgage"?

    A loan for purchasing property
  • What does "mogul" mean?

    A powerful or influential person
  • What is a "miscreant"?

    A wrongdoer or villain
  • What does "misogynist" mean?

    Someone who dislikes or prejudices against women
  • What does "nebulous" mean?

    Vague or unclear
  • What is a "novice"?

    A beginner or someone new to a field
  • What does "obsequious" mean?

    Overly obedient or eager to please
  • What does "opulent" mean?

    Rich and luxurious
  • What does "ostracise" mean?

    To exclude someone from a group
